The rising discourse on the modernization of equity markets is intensifying as Robinhood CEO Vlad Tenev advocates for tokenized stocks. His advocacy comes amid growing dissatisfaction with the existing settlement infrastructure, which he argues, is obsolete and incapable of withstanding extreme market conditions. A pertinent instance highlighting these vulnerabilities was the GameStop episode in 2021, where retail investors faced trading restrictions, sparking widespread controversy and debate.
Revisiting the GameStop Saga: An Industry Wake-Up Call
The GameStop saga in early 2021 is often revisited as a quintessential example of the flaws inherent in traditional equity market systems. During this period, a surge in trading frenzy around certain ‘meme stocks,’ primarily GameStop, led to Robinhood and other brokerage firms halting purchases of these stocks. This halt was due not to intentional brokerage misconduct but to limitations imposed by outdated settlement processes. Retail investors, feeling marginalized, saw this as a significant failure in the system’s ability to handle volatility.
Robinhood’s Tenev was vocal in pointing out that the delayed settlement cycle—a T+2 system—was a root cause for this debacle. These periodic and extended settlement cycles mandate that trades are not settled instantly. Consequently, firms are required to maintain substantial collateral to mitigate counterparty risks, which becomes increasingly problematic as trading volumes skyrocket.
Tokenization: A Structural Solution?
Tokenization, a process by which ownership of an asset is represented by blockchain-based tokens, offers a compelling alternative to traditional equities settlement processes. According to Tenev, transitioning to a tokenized system could effectively resolve the challenges inherent in a T+1 or T+2 settlement environment. This approach allows for instantaneous or atomic trade settlements, virtually eliminating counterparty risk and consequently reducing the demand for high collateral buffers.
Furthermore, tokenization brings to the table additional advantages like 24-hour trading and the ability to own fractional shares, leveraging blockchain’s transparent and immutable ledger for enhanced investor confidence. These features not only promise increased liquidity but also democratize access to the stock market by lowering the barrier to entry for retail investors.

Robinhood’s European Experiment and Beyond
Robinhood has not simply theorized this transition but has also embarked on a practical experiment within Europe. The company offers tokenized representations of over 2,000 U.S.-listed stocks and exchange-traded funds, allowing investors to experience real-time trading without the burdens of traditional collateral requirements. This strategy has led to the creation of nearly 2,000 stock tokens valued under $17 million, a figure relatively conservative in comparison to larger tokenization efforts but significant in proving the model’s viability.
The current initiatives are a mere prelude to Robinhood’s broader strategic vision, which includes around-the-clock trading features and further integration into decentralized finance (DeFi) platforms. The firm aims to explore self-custody of digital assets and lending mechanisms, aspects that distinguish blockchain’s limitless innovation potential from conventional finance’s rigid frameworks.
Navigating the Regulatory Landscape
As Robinhood and other fintech innovators press forward with tokenization, regulatory oversight remains a crucial factor. The New York Stock Exchange (NYSE) and Nasdaq’s interests in blockchain-facilitated financial instruments signal an imminent industry shift. These exchanges are working towards launching platforms capable of handling tokenized securities, contingent upon obtaining necessary regulatory clearances.
While the tokenized model holds potential, regulators, particularly the U.S. Securities and Exchange Commission (SEC), continue to emphasize that such innovations must abide by existing securities laws. The legal status of securities remains unaffected whether they are integrated onto a blockchain or maintained using traditional ledgers. In 2026, the SEC introduced a pilot project with the Depository Trust Company to tokenize various U.S. Treasuries and notable ETFs, a move illustrating regulatory willingness to explore tokenization while ensuring investor protection.
